Sri Lanka records Rs. 9.5 billion budget surplus in first half of 2026
Sri Lanka, July 31 -- Sri Lanka recorded a budget surplus of Rs. 9.5 billion during the first half of 2026, marking a significant recovery from the Rs. 405.6 billion deficit registered during the same period in 2025.
Total government revenue and grants rose by 27.1% year-on-year to reach Rs. 2.95 trillion between January and June, according to the Finance Ministry's Fiscal Review Report. This performance represents 55.8% of the Rs. 5.3 trillion annual estimate.
